Si estás interesado en crear una página web con PHP y MySQL, estás en el lugar correcto. En este artículo, te enseñaremos cómo hacer una página web en PHP y MySQL desde cero.
¿Qué es PHP y MySQL?
PHP es un lenguaje de programación utilizado para crear páginas web dinámicas. MySQL, por otro lado, es un sistema de gestión de bases de datos que se utiliza para almacenar y recuperar información. Juntos, PHP y MySQL hacen posible crear sitios web interactivos y dinámicos.
Paso 1: Configuración de un servidor web
Para poder crear una página web en PHP y MySQL, necesitarás un servidor web. Hay varias opciones disponibles, pero una de las más populares es XAMPP. Descarga e instala XAMPP en tu ordenador.
Paso 2: Crear una base de datos MySQL
Una vez que hayas instalado XAMPP, abre el panel de control y asegúrate de que el servidor Apache y MySQL estén en funcionamiento. Luego, abre tu navegador web y escribe «localhost» en la barra de direcciones.
Para crear una base de datos MySQL, haz clic en el enlace «phpMyAdmin» en la página principal de XAMPP. Haz clic en el botón «Nuevo» en la página que se abre y crea una nueva base de datos con un nombre de tu elección.
Paso 3: Crear una página web en PHP
Una vez que hayas configurado tu servidor web y creado una base de datos MySQL, es hora de crear tu página web en PHP. Abre tu editor de texto favorito y crea un nuevo archivo PHP. Escribe el siguiente código:
<?php // Conectar a la base de datos $conexion = mysqli_connect("localhost", "nombre_de_usuario", "contraseña", "nombre_de_base_de_datos"); // Comprobar la conexión if($conexion === false){ die("ERROR: No se pudo conectar con la base de datos. " . mysqli_connect_error()); } ?>
Este código conecta tu página web con la base de datos MySQL que acabas de crear.
Paso 4: Mostrar datos de la base de datos en tu página web
Ahora que has conectado tu página web con la base de datos MySQL, es hora de mostrar datos en tu página web. Escribe el siguiente código:
<?php // Conectar a la base de datos $conexion = mysqli_connect("localhost", "nombre_de_usuario", "contraseña", "nombre_de_base_de_datos"); // Comprobar la conexión if($conexion === false){ die("ERROR: No se pudo conectar con la base de datos. " . mysqli_connect_error()); } // Obtener datos de la base de datos $resultado = mysqli_query($conexion, "SELECT * FROM tabla"); // Mostrar datos en la página web while($fila = mysqli_fetch_array($resultado)){ echo "<p>" . $fila['columna1'] . " - " . $fila['columna2'] . "</p>"; } // Cerrar la conexión mysqli_close($conexion); ?>
Este código obtiene datos de la base de datos MySQL y los muestra en tu página web.
Conclusión
Crear una página web en PHP y MySQL puede parecer intimidante al principio, pero con un poco de práctica, puedes crear sitios web dinámicos e interactivos. Si sigues los pasos que hemos descrito en este artículo, estarás en camino de crear tu primera página web en PHP y MySQL.